Frequently Asked Questions

Is Schloss Johannisberg the birthplace of Spätlese?
Yes, the estate discovered the Spätlese style by accident in 1775 when the harvest was delayed, leading to the production of noble rot wines.
What grape variety does Schloss Johannisberg produce?
The estate exclusively cultivates Riesling to maintain its focus on the highest quality and regional identity.

How long can their wines be aged?
Schloss Johannisberg wines are renowned for their exceptional aging potential, with top vintages capable of evolving beautifully for several decades.
